2009 Buick Lucerne vs. 1980 Isuzu Florian

To start off, 2009 Buick Lucerne is newer by 29 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1980 Isuzu Florian.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1980 Isuzu Florian would be higher. At 3,879 cc (6 cylinders), 2009 Buick Lucerne is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2009 Buick Lucerne (224 HP @ 5700 RPM) has 127 more horse power than 1980 Isuzu Florian. (97 HP @ 5400 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2009 Buick Lucerne should accelerate faster than 1980 Isuzu Florian.

Because 1980 Isuzu Florian is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1980 Isuzu Florian.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2009 Buick Lucerne,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2009 Buick Lucerne (237 Nm @ 3200 RPM) has 90 more torque (in Nm) than 1980 Isuzu Florian. (147 Nm @ 3800 RPM). This means 2009 Buick Lucerne will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1980 Isuzu Florian. 2009 Buick Lucerne has automatic transmission and 1980 Isuzu Florian has manual transmission. 1980 Isuzu Florian will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2009 Buick Lucerne will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.
